Before buying a built-in refrigerator it is important to consider several factors. First, you must determine the dimensions of your desired space. Measure the length, width and height of the room to determine whether it is large enough to accommodate the fridge. Check the electrical requirements and ensure that there is enough space for ventilation.

Compare the features and costs of various appliances before making a choice. Many of the most sought-after appliances come with smart controls that permit you to control and alter settings remotely. You should also check the appliance's energy label for details on its efficiency and environmental impact.

In addition to the aesthetic benefits, a built-in fridge can be more convenient than freestanding refrigerators. Side-by-side models, for instance come with separate compartments for freezer and refrigerator, making it easier to reach both food items without having bend or reach. Some models are equipped with ice and bottled water dispensers to make it easy to get chilled drinks. Other handy features include frost-free technology which eliminates the need for manual defrosting and helps to keep food at optimal levels of moisture. Some models have adjustable door bins and freezer drawers for better organization. Some also prioritize energy efficiency by prioritizing colder freezer temperatures and reducing noise levels.
